**Position Summary**

This position requires a highly organized individual who possesses strong initiative and has the ability to complete multiple projects in a deadline driven environment. This individual must be able to communicate effectively and understands the need to work in an integrated manner with other members of the department in furtherance of goals, objectives, and knowledge.

**Job Essentials, Responsibilities, Duties**
- Directly supervises 2 employees within the corporate team.
- Carries out supervisory responsibilities in accordance with the organization's policies and applicable laws.
- Responsibilities include interviewing, hiring, and training employees; planning, assigning, and directing work; appraising performance; rewarding and disciplining employees; addressing complaints and resolving problems.
- Maintains knowledge of trends, best practices, regulatory changes, and new technologies in human resources, talent management, and employment law.
- Maintains compliance with federal, state, and local employment laws and regulations, and recommended best practices; reviews policies and practices to maintain compliance.
- Promotes and implements positive employee relations through design, communication, and interpretation of human resources policies and programs.
- Manages relocation, employee communication, employee safety and community relations and responds to inquiries regarding policies, procedures, and programs.
- Partners with the leadership team to understand and execute the organization’s human resource and talent strategy particularly as it relates to current and future talent needs, recruiting, retention, and succession planning.
- Coordinates training programs, personal and career development, performance appraisal process, succession planning, compensation systems, diversity, and benefit programs.
- Manage all processes and systems related to Human Resources.
- Manage and maintain Tri Star Merit & Goal Program, COL Raises, and Rockstar Bonus Program.
- Provides support and guidance to management, and other staff when complex, specialized, and sensitive questions and issues arise; may be required to administer and execute routine tasks in delicate circumstances such as providing reasonable accommodations, investigating allegations of wrongdoing, and terminations.
- Conducts investigations and implements proper remedial action in response to facts obtained through investigative process.
- Coordinates employee-relations activities and programs including but not limited to employee counseling, interpretation of policies, new employee orientation, and employee recognition programs.
- Prepares and monitors human resources budget.
- Analyzes trends in compensation and benefits; researches and proposes competitive base and incentive pay programs to ensure the organization attracts and retains top talent.
- Oversees employee disciplinary meetings, terminations, and investigations.
- Performs other related duties as assigned by management.
